How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- holding that inmate Veteto's self-deposition did not comply with Rules 30, 31, or *Page 575 32 because it was not \on oath\ and had not been taken pursuant to leave of court as required by Rules 30 or 31
- noting a \long line of opinions\ following \unwaveringly\ the rule that \an incarcerated civil plaintiff is not entitled to be brought from the penitentiary to testify in his own behalf\
